{"value":{"id":1908722,"askingMemberId":4850,"askingMember":null,"house":"Commons","memberHasInterest":false,"dateTabled":"2026-05-21T00:00:00","dateForAnswer":"2026-06-01T00:00:00","uin":"3829","questionText":"To ask the Secretary of State for Business and Trade, what steps his Department is taking to improve domestic manufacturing supply chains for the car industry.","answeringBodyId":214,"answeringBodyName":"Department for Business and Trade","isWithdrawn":false,"isNamedDay":false,"groupedQuestions":[],"answerIsHolding":false,"answerIsCorrection":false,"answeringMemberId":5116,"answeringMember":null,"correctingMemberId":null,"correctingMember":null,"dateAnswered":"2026-06-02T00:00:00","answerText":"<p>The Government is supporting investment into the transformation of our supply chains through DRIVE35, a £4 billion programme to 2035 funding the R&amp;D, commercial scale-up and industrialisation of zero emission vehicle manufacturing in the UK.</p><p>This in addition to wider interventions to improve competitiveness and attract investment across the sector, including up to £100m under DRIVE35 for two EV manufacturing clusters in the North-East and the West Midlands.</p><p>We have also established a Supply Chain Centre within DBT to improve data on risks and strengthen the resilience of critical manufacturing supply chains.</p>","originalAnswerText":"","comparableAnswerText":"","dateAnswerCorrected":null,"dateHoldingAnswer":null,"attachmentCount":0,"heading":"Motor Vehicles: Manufacturing Industries","attachments":[],"groupedQuestionsDates":[]},"links":[{"rel":"self","href":"/Questions/1908722","method":"GET"}]}
